Bolt-on Hubs are precision-engineered mechanical components designed for seamless integration with universally accepted taper bushes. These hubs provide a high-strength, reliable connection between rotating shafts and various industrial attachments, ensuring maximum stability and efficient power transmission in demanding environments.
Specifically optimized for fastening fan rotors, impellers, agitators, and other critical devices, our Bolt-on Hubs ensure that equipment remains firmly secured to the shaft, minimizing vibration and preventing slippage. Available in BF and SM series as well as specialized Assembly Hubs, they offer the versatility required for diverse general equipment manufacturing applications.

They are primarily used to securely fasten rotating components such as fan rotors, impellers, and agitators to shafts using taper bushes, ensuring a firm, vibration-free connection.
Our Bolt-on Hubs are specifically designed for use with universally accepted taper bushes, ensuring broad compatibility across different industry standards.
BF and SM series differ in their dimensional specifications and load capacities to suit different sizes of fan rotors and industrial agitators.
By utilizing the taper lock mechanism, the hub creates a high-friction interference fit that distributes clamping force evenly around the shaft, eliminating slippage.
Yes, they are engineered specifically for the gear and transmission industry to handle significant torque loads while maintaining structural integrity.
Standard industrial wrenches and tools are typically sufficient for tightening the bolts that secure the taper bush within the hub.
